This study applies and further develops realistic evaluation and realist review to provide an evaluation and synthesis method for complex social programmes such as counter violent extremism (CVE). The end result is heuristic development of the realistic evaluation method which provides a basis for future CVE evaluation studies.

Amy-Jane Gielen is a political scientist who completed her dissertation at the Amsterdam Institute for Social Science Research (AISSR), University of Amsterdam. She has more than a decade of experience in evaluating CVE and advising governments on a local, regional and national level.
